Transaction 4f553afa7016c76acd11f702b6652392a58c15087061b93d1433a87914ed888f

8 Input
2 Outputs
  • 4f553afa7016c76acd11f702b6652392a58c15087061b93d1433a87914ed888f:0
  • value  1588003
    address  14H4kZCtTf3BrbwYp8svjPkesdgGEEZTTB
  • 4f553afa7016c76acd11f702b6652392a58c15087061b93d1433a87914ed888f:1
  • value  96254900
    address  178JaQZAwAYQsk18srxUp1AwnPEBtE57za